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Asbestos victims should seek legal representation through national firms that specialize asbestos cases.

A reputable mesothelioma law firm provides free assessment of cases to determine if you are eligible for compensation. Furthermore, the top mesothelioma attorneys work on a contingency basis. This arrangement allows for the highest compensation for clients.

1. Experience

If you or someone you love suffers from mesothelioma or asbestosis or any other asbestos-related disease it is essential to find a lawyer with experience to help you get compensation. Asbestos-related sufferers are able to sue companies that exposed them to asbestos. This will compensate them for the financial loss they suffer.

Asbestos victims have the time to file claims or they could be barred from taking legal action. A skilled New York asbestos attorney can assist you in filing your claim within the deadlines set by law and ensure that applicable laws are adhered to.

Mesothelioma lawyers have expertise in the complexities of regulations and rules that surround asbestos litigation. They also have the skills necessary to gather evidence and construct a compelling case before juries and judges. A top-rated attorney will have a track record in helping clients receive fair and full compensation for losses.

New York is home to some of the most prominent mesothelioma lawyers in America among them are Weitz & Luxenberg Cooney & Conway and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team consisting of attorneys and paralegals that can help you file an asbestos lawsuit in the state that is most likely to succeed.

Asbestos litigation is of a national scope and the majority of large mesothelioma firms have a national reach. It is nevertheless important to hire an asbestos attorney who has an office in your area and is able to meet with you in person if you are able. Local offices let you feel more comfortable discussing your case, and can make the process easier by removing some of the stress associated with traveling.

If you're interviewing candidates, ask each about their experience in asbestos litigation. Find out what the firm's approach is for each case and the way it plans to fight on your behalf. Make sure to find out who will manage your case (non-lawyer case managers are usually employed by larger firms) and how long it takes them to respond to your emails or phone calls.

A mesothelioma settlement or verdict may cover medical expenses, lost wages, home care expenses funeral and burial costs, and other expenses. Many victims receive millions of dollars in compensation.

2. Reputation

If you're looking for the most favorable result for your mesothelioma lawsuit, hire a law office that has years of experience and a presence across the nation. These asbestos case firms are acquainted with the different state laws and asbestos litigation. This process is simplified and will save you both time and stress when you are seeking compensation. This lets you focus more on your family, and medical care, instead of trying to navigate the legal system.

Attorneys with a great reputation have a track record of obtaining compensation for victims as well as families. They have access to a wealth of resources such as industry records and historical data. They have the experience and experience to identify responsible asbestos companies and submit a lawsuit or trust fund claim. These lawyers have a passion for justice and the desire to hold asbestos companies accountable for their blunders. For instance, the renowned asbestos settlement attorney; like it, Joseph D. Satterley has personal connections to the disease due to his grandfather's mesothelioma diagnosis. He has won several mult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ma lawsuits, including the first verdict by a jury ever against Colgate-Palmolive for its renowned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

4. Flexibility

For those who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ases, they may seek compensation from the companies that exposed them to this dangerous carcinogen. This can include compensation for future and past medical bills, loss of income, loss of consortium and pain and suffering and funeral expenses.

A mesothelioma lawyer can help you identify the parties accountable for your losses and assist you through the litigation or settlement process. Asbestos-related illness claims are often complex and can take years to resolve. An experienced lawyer will fight for you and your loved family members until justice is done.

The best mesothelioma attorneys will have the resources and experience needed to ensure the highest value of your case. A lawyer's history of fighting for asbestos victims exposure can give you peace assurance that he is the right choice to handle your claim.

asbestos compensation lawyers are known to get millions of dollars in settlements for their clients. They also have been successful in obtaining significant verdicts in court. Some m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os-related cases. others have a wide range of practice areas and focus on representing clients suffering from various types of illnesses.

Once you've created an inventory of candidates, you can schedule an interview for them. Bring your employment history along with medical records, as well as any other pertinent information to the meeting. Ask the lawyers to discuss how they anticipate the case will develop and the timeframe for an agreement. Also, you should inquire about fees and costs. Mesothelioma attorneys usually charge a contingent fee, meaning they will get a percentage of any money you collect.
